Picking the Right Fence for Your Leavenworth Backyard
6 ft Privacy Fences
The most common backyard fence we install in Leavenworth. 6 ft height clears most City of Leavenworth residential codes without a variance, blocks line-of-sight from neighbors, and pairs well with shadowbox or board-on-board styles. Cedar is the long-term call; pressure-treated pine is the budget pick.
8 ft Privacy & Sound Fences
For Leavenworth homes that back up to busy roads or commercial corridors, an 8 ft fence cuts road noise meaningfully and provides true backyard privacy. The City of Leavenworth typically requires a variance for over 6 ft — we file the paperwork.
Pool Fences
Leavenworth requires self-closing, self-latching gates and minimum 4 ft enclosures around residential pools. We build to code in the first round so your final inspection is a formality, not a redo.

Why Leavenworth Homeowners Hire Uprise for Fence Installation
Posts Set Below Frost Line
The local frost line is roughly 36 inches. We set posts deeper than that in concrete on every install — so your fence doesn't lean at the corners after the first hard winter.
